Orange Cliffs Overlook is located almost at the south end of the Grand View Point Road in the Island In The Sky District of the Canyonlands National Park near Moab in the State of Utah. After parking your vehicle (there is a limited number of spaces, around 8) it is an easy 0.1-mile out-and-back trail that leads to the stunning panoramic view of the Orange Cliffs. It is a very short out-and-back walk along a dirt trail that gradually leads downhill to the edge of the canyon. Hikers will find panoramic views at the end of the trail with a westward-facing vista that encompasses vast swaths of Canyonlands National Park's interior of the Upper and Lower West Basin Zones. The overlook is thus named because of the color of the cliffs. Visitors need to be careful not to venture too close to the rim of the cliff for fear of the dangers of falling over. If visitors also want to visit the Grand View Point Overlook, which is only a very short distance to the south at the end of the Grand View Point Road, I suggest that you should leave your vehicle parked at the Orange Cliffs Overlook parking, since the Grand View Point Overlook is a very popular site and parking is difficult to find.

The Orange Cliffs Overlook is just north of the Grand View Point at the southern end of the Scenic Drive in the Island in the Sky section of Canyonlands National Park. There is no proper car park at this particular overlook, just a pullover with space for a few vehicles. From here, you can peer into the distance to the west and see the cliffs which shine in bright orangish colour when hit with sunlight. Along with the generally outstanding landscape and land formations, this is one of several incredible viewpoints to enjoy during drives through Island in the Sky.

Beautiful views as everywhere in Canyonlands. We visited in April, weather wasn't the best, overcast, cold, windy with few sprinkles of rain and in spite of all that we weren't able to find parking at the Grand View Point Overlook parking area. Orange cliffs is just a short walk from that parking area so I highly recommend you park here if you're planning on taking the Grand View Point Overlook hike, because there are no views from the road there, you have to walk.
